getParameterSets

Класс: sltest.testmanager. TestCase
Пакет: sltest.testmanager

Получите наборы параметра теста

Синтаксис

psets = getParameterSets(tc)
psets = getParameterSets(tc,simulationIndex)

Описание

psets = getParameterSets(tc) получает наборы параметра в тесте и возвращает их, когда массив набора параметра возражает, sltest.testmanager.ParameterSet.

psets = getParameterSets(tc,simulationIndex) получает наборы параметра в тесте и возвращает их, когда массив набора параметра возражает, sltest.testmanager.ParameterSet. Если тест является эквивалентным тестом, то задайте индекс симуляции.

Входные параметры

развернуть все

Тест, чтобы получить тестовые воздействия от, заданный как объект sltest.testmanager.TestCase.

Номер симуляции, к которому наборы параметра применяются, заданный как целое число, 1 или 2. Эта установка применяется к тесту симуляции, где существует две симуляции. Для базовой линии и тестов симуляции, индексом симуляции по умолчанию является 1.

Выходные аргументы

развернуть все

Наборы параметра, которые принадлежат тесту, возвратились как массив объектов sltest.testmanager.ParameterSet.

Примеры

развернуть все

% Create the test file, test suite, and test case structure
tf = sltest.testmanager.TestFile('API Test File');
ts = createTestSuite(tf,'API Test Suite');
tc = createTestCase(ts,'baseline','Baseline API Test Case');

% Assign the system under test to the test case
setProperty(tc,'Model','sldemo_absbrake');

% Test a new model parameter by overriding it in the test case
% parameter set
ps = addParameterSet(tc,'Name','API Parameter Set');
po = addParameterOverride(ps,'m',55);

% Get and check the parameter set
psets = getParameterSets(tc);

Введенный в R2015b